Output 8efc8d36c609c5ad7db969134c59cac1f47b393f496ecdf812c3b59a378e1d75: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0717e355885c725ad7a2f656f089f7a21ee108de OP_EQUAL
address
32LXGeyZvGjASK2TVRxxU979EbA48CRz2A
transaction
8efc8d36c609c5ad7db969134c59cac1f47b393f496ecdf812c3b59a378e1d75
spent
true